We Are All Underrating Cardinals' Defense

by Will Brinson

The Arizona Cardinals are famous in 2008 because Kurt Warner, Larry Fitzgerald (currently an unstoppable force), and Anquan Boldin comprise a ridiculous aerial attack. But the truth is that the Cardinal defense deserves a lot more credit than they're getting.

Look at the score, folks: it's 24-6. That's not just because the Cards offense is good and the Eagles are struggling. Troy Aikman keeps mentioning "missed opportunities" for the Eagles offense (right before Adrian Wilson comes tearing off the corner to smother McNabb), and I distinctly remember everyone (guilty as charged) blaming the totality of the Panthers' loss on Jake Delhomme and not the Cardinals defense.
